Garry's Mod

Garry's Mod

30 ratings
[LambdaPlayers] Vote System Module
   
Award
Favorite
Favorited
Unfavorite
Content Type: Addon
Addon Type: NPC
Addon Tags: Comic, Fun, Roleplay
File Size
Posted
Updated
26.458 KB
26 Mar @ 9:43am
27 Mar @ 11:35am
2 Change Notes ( view )

Subscribe to download
[LambdaPlayers] Vote System Module

Description
Lambda Players - Vote System
A module for Lambda Players which adds in a simple functioning voting system, which grants the likes of both lambda and players the ability to:
  • Create and initialize brand new votes with a chat command
  • Partake by voting on an option of preference with a chat command
  • Change the outcome of an entire vote and potentially influence the final result

For those who don't exactly know, the vote system is specifically a feature that originally deviated from a previous iteration of Lambda Players which is known as:
Zeta Players

Well, I wanted to recreate something similar like the one shown there, but also taking in and considering ideas during development to make the whole system as flexible as possible in terms of customization, like creating a panel where you can create new votes, export voting data into a file, and even import in voting data from other files.

Vote System Commands
!startvote | Used to create new votes. Example: !startvote "TitleName" {Options}
NOTE: Each given option when typing must be separated with the separator: (|) with spaces included towards the end of the option and the beginning of the separator as follows.

!vote | Used to vote in for an option. Example: !vote "OptionName"

Credits
StarFrost: Created the Lambda Players addon.
orange5096: Created the module.
10 Comments
qwertypop727 5 Apr @ 9:01pm 
Is it possible to make it so that inscriptions like /rndply/ work in voting? Like
instead of "/rndply/ is a good player?" it would be "Beta (or another nickname) is a good player?".
Critas 3 Apr @ 2:56pm 
o7
Guyguyga 2 Apr @ 9:09pm 
could you help me with some lambda modules? I'd like to add you if you're willing
elite dozer 1 Apr @ 3:42am 
i just cant seem to start a vote, but maybe im just a complete idiot... yeah lets go with that
Jaxxon51 29 Mar @ 3:03pm 
It's finally back, i am archiving this addon for the rest of my life
qwertypop727 29 Mar @ 3:34am 
thanks, I didn't see the new tab after cleaning addons
orange5096  [author] 29 Mar @ 3:28am 
@qwertypop727 There is a way to make the vote go on for longer. Look within the Vote System category within the Lambda Player Tab and look out for the setting "Vote Duration" which will allow you to configure the time that a vote will last for.
qwertypop727 29 Mar @ 3:22am 
is it possible to make the voting last longer? because in my opinion the voting goes quickly.
remember, I am writing this through a translator
Spilledmilk 27 Mar @ 6:11pm 
Thank you orange5096 for having such a large brain
halflife2combine 27 Mar @ 11:31am 
YES IT EXISTS NOW :D